Walter Hassan
Walter Thomas Frederick Hassan
Early life
Hassan was born in London where his father, of Northern Irish descent, owned a clothes store in Holloway. His natural interest was always in mechanical things.[1] As it was told, his uncle encouraged him to be a creator since his uncle was building model ships.
He studied at the Northern Polytechnic Institute (subsequently renamed and amalgamated by stages into London Metropolitan University) and then Hackney Technical Institute of Engineering.[2] The Regent Street Polytechnic (now incorporated into the University of Westminster) has also been named.[1]
Bentley
Hassan's first job was as a 15 year-old[1] shop boy in W. O. Bentley's newly founded Bentley Motors,[2] employee No. 14. He was a fitter in the engine shop then in the chassis shop, gaining a complete experience of the 3-litre cars then in production.
He eventually moved to road testing working under the head of experimental department (today's R&D) Frank Clement, the company's professional racing driver, and was a riding mechanic in some races. In the off-season he was part of the Bentley Motors service department.
Establishing himself as the best Bentley mechanic, he was allotted to Woolf Barnato, their top driver and Bentley Motors chairman and shareholder. They established a close and lasting friendship.[1]
After it was put into liquidation and taken over by Rolls-Royce at the end of 1931 Hassan left Bentley Motors and worked for Barnato. In 1933, he started to build a racing car that would become known as Barnato Hassan and was one of the fastest cars ever to lap Brooklands. Later he developed a car for Bill Pacey, known as the Pacey-Hassan. It was a success on the British racing circuits in the 1936 season. By now he had become a family man and accordingly sought out more stable employment.[2] He had married in 1933 and he went on to have four children.
ERA
Hassan then spent time at Raymond Mays' ERA at Bourne in Lincolnshire working there with Peter Berthon on engine development and at Brooklands with Thompson and Taylor on ERA chassis development.[1]
The vast majority of prewar ERAs are still in existence and they have continuous and verifiable provenance. They still compete in historic events despite the youngest being nearly seventy years old (as of 2018).

Jaguar V12
Coventry Climax was bought by Jaguar in 1963. Bill Heynes and Claude Baily, the original V12 engine designers, were then joined by Hassan and together they went on to develop the Jaguar V12 engine.[3]
In later years, Le Mans-winning Jaguars were powered with a modified V12 racing engine.
A 7.0-litre V12 based on the production 5.3-litre engine powered the winning Jaguar XJR-9 in June 1988.
A Jaguar XJR-12 powered by a 7-litre 60 degree SOHC V12 won in June 1990. During that race it covered 4882.4 km at an average speed of 204.036 km/h / 126.782 mph with a maximum trap speed of 353 km/h / 219 mph.
